Search for new heavy quarks in electron-muon events at the Fermilab Tevatron Collider

Abstract
A search for tt¯→eμ+X in pp¯ collisions at s√¯ TeV is described. The production and decay of top-quarkantiquark pairs is considered in the context of the standard model. The analysis is based on data with an integrated luminosity of 4.4 pb1 recorded with the Collider Detector at Fermilab. An upper limit on the tt¯ cross section is obtained, and the top quark in the mass range 2872 GeV/c2 is excluded at the 95% C.L. The same limits apply to a possible fourth-generation, charge -(1/3, b’ quark, decaying via the charged current.
